What Types of Work and Facilities Can School Occupational Therapists Expect in Navasota, TX?

As a School Occupational Therapist in Navasota, Texas, you can expect to work in a variety of educational settings that cater to the diverse needs of students with varying disabilities and learning challenges. In this charming community, you may find opportunities within public and private schools, specialized therapy clinics, and collaborative environments that involve working closely with teachers, school psychologists, and parents. Your role will focus on enhancing students’ fine motor skills, sensory processing abilities, and daily living activities, all aimed at improving their academic performance and social integration. Additionally, you may have the chance to participate in Individualized Education Program (IEP) meetings, providing valuable insights and strategies to support each child’s unique development while helping to create inclusive learning environments. AMN Healthcare is partnering with a well-respected school district in Rockford, Illinois, to offer a full-time Occupational Therapist (OT) position for the remainder of the 2026–2027 school year. This school-based role consists of 37.5 hours per week and provides an opportunity to make a meaningful impact on students’ lives. As an OT in this setting, you will conduct evaluations to assess students’ motor, sensory, and functional abilities, develop and implement individualized therapy plans aligned with IEPs, and provide direct therapy services to improve fine and gross motor skills, sensory processing, and self-help skills. You’ll collaborate closely with educators and families to adapt classroom environments and activities, participate in IEP meetings, and maintain documentation in compliance with school and state regulations.
